Golang Developer:
The Select Group is looking for a mid-level Golang Developer for one of their top Telecommunication clients. This is going to be a long term contract, located in Mt. Laurel, NJ (4 days onsite, 1 day remote).
Golang Developer Requirements:
- 1+ years with Golang – coding for design and performance of application
- GraphQL experience
- AWS cloud experience preferred
- Open to other similar cloud experience (Azure, GCP)
- Experience working with both SQL and NoSQL databases for efficient data storage and retrieval
- Driven mentality, always looking for a challenge
Golang Developer Responsibilities:
- Implementing NQL and GQL Services: Write code in Golang to enhance real-time (NQL) and non-real-time (GQL) data services as outlined in the Genome project, ensuring efficient data collection and retrieval mechanisms under supervision.
- Secure Coding Practices in USM KEY: Assist in the development and maintenance of the USM KEY service, focusing on secure authentication, private key management, and encryption protocols for cable modems.
- Collaborative Software Development: Participate in collaborative software development with engineering teams, ensuring effective communication and coordination, including regular code reviews and knowledge sharing.
- Defect Identification and Documentation: Assist in identifying, reproducing, and documenting software defects, particularly in the context of the Genome project. Support thorough testing and documentation practices.
- Optimizing Software Performance: Assist in the performance optimization of the software by identifying areas for improvement and implementing enhancements to meet project objectives.
- Adhering to Quality Assurance Practices: Support the application of quality assurance practices, such as inspecting, testing, and evaluating software, to guarantee accuracy and reliability in line with the Genome project's standards.
- Engagement with Technical Components: Engage with the specific technical components of the Genome project, including Golang, NQL, GQL, and USM KEY.